Finally one that my cat will take!
posted 5 years ago
After many different brands and flavors, my cat Tori has finally decided that this is the formula for her. I just put some of my finger and she licks it right off. We call it her "vitamin" and I try to give her some every couple of days. Medium haired cats can have a lot of hairballs and I have noticed a great improvement since we started using this product. My other cat will not even attempt to take this - she runs as soon as she sees it. Every now and then I smear some on her paws and on her treats.
Pros: Easy to adminster, works great
Cons: Only one of my cats will willing take this

Hairball prevention
posted 5 years ago
I prefer to use 'natural' remedies but find this product really helps more than other solutions I've tried. I have 1 cat who gets frequent hairballs, so I give him a little of this a couple times a week. He doesn't care for the malt taste, so I have to mix it in his food. (The tuna is more palatable but harder to find.)
Pros: prevents hairballs if used consistently
